Bolton nets a pair in QC's 4-1 win over Bloomfield

Kirri Bolton scored the first of her two second half goals in the 50th minute to break a 1-1 deadlock and propel the Lady Knights to a 4-1 non-conference victory over Bloomfiled College on Wednesday in Flushing, New York.
QC dominated play but Bloomfield was the beneficiary of a bad bounce, taking a 1-0 lead at 10:36 when Erika Len directed a ball into the box that deflected off a Lady Knights defender, caromed over netminder Allison Breakey, and found the back of the cage for an own goal. Andrea Slavin evened the score for Queens College 18 minutes later when she converted on a penalty kick for her fifth goal of the season. Slavin now has a goal in each of QC's five games.
The Lady Knights took the lead for good when Bolton scored her first collegiate goal at 49:52. In the 79th minute QC put the game away with two markers 2:18 apart from Brittany Silipo and Bolton.
